Your Responsibilities
In your role as a Senior Structural Technician, you will:
- Produce BIM models, 3D designs, and 2D CAD drawings using REVIT, Navisworks, and AutoCAD to support tenders and project delivery.
- Check and coordinate building structures information in a quality assurance environment.
- Support bid and tender activities, including feasibility studies and concept design development.
- Undertake site inspections to ensure compliance with CDM Regulations and British/European Standards.
- Contribute to design deliverables, including calculations, reports, and risk assessments.
What We’re Looking For
This role is perfect for you if you:
- Hold a Bachelor’s degree (construction-related) or HNC/BTEC in Structural/Civil Engineering, Building, or Construction.
- Have extensive experience producing building structures models and drawings compliant with CDM Regulations and relevant standards.
- Possess strong knowledge of reinforced concrete detailing and scheduling to relevant standards.
- Are highly capable in REVIT, Navisworks, and AutoCAD on building structures projects.
- Hold a Full driving licence.
